plural superfans
: an extremely enthusiastic or dedicated fan
superfans, people absolutely enveloped by their passion.George Plimpton
… is considering placing cameras around his team's complex and having superfans pay to tune in …Peter King
To coaches and college presidents, boosters are superfans willing to put their money where their hearts are.Robert Lipsyte

Word History

First Known Use

1918, in the meaning defined above
